..... alties on other appellants in terms of Rule 26 of the Central Excise Rules, 2002. 2. Learned Counsel appearing for the main appellant submitted that proceedings by the original authority are seriously in violation of principles of natural justice. He submitted that the case against the appellant is main l y based on various statements and certain documents. The appellants did receive all the duty paid inputs and duly used for manufacture of dutiable final products. They did maintain all records. The present case heavily relied on the statements to corroborate the allegations of Revenue regarding the improper documents or non receipt of inputs in the factory. To support their evidence, the appellants have pleaded for cross examination of .....

..... not defend their case due to non - availability of the documents. He prays for supply of the documents so that they can file effective defence. Learned Counsel also pleaded that an opportunity of personal hearing may be granted to the appellant. 4. Learned AR defending the impugned order submitted that case has been made against the main appellant based on various corroborative evidence. The findings are elaborate and clear. 5. We have heard Shri N K Sharma, Shri Ramesh Goel, Shri Monish Panda, Shri Amit Kumar Bhattacharya and Shri R K Verma, learned advocates/CA for the appellants and Shri R K Mishra, learned DR for the Revenue and perused the appeal records. 6.
